Specified-Lengths Policy for Mon Reale®, Embossed & Traditional Mouldings
Tallying Policy
This industry-standard policy will allow customers to correctly receive the stock that is pulled to meet their orders. All mouldings are tallied to the nearest foot. For example, if the actual length is 11'5", the tallied length is 11'. If the actual length is 11'7", the tallied length is 12'. If the actual length is 11'6", the tallied length is 11'.
FedEx Orders
Specified lengths on FedEx orders are subject to an upcharge of 20% (30% Mon Reale®) plus additional LF needed to pull the order. Many orders with FedEx piece counts are exceeding the cost to ship LTL. To FedEx five bundles can be the same as an $100 LTL charge. Many of the truck lines we use to ship LTL have shipping schedules within a day of regular FedEx ground.
Examples
The following examples would be subject to specified-length charges: 3 pc 8' CA37POP. The following example is NOT subject to specified-length charges: 24' CA37POP, ship FedEx. This order will be pulled random length with no upcharge. Normally, we will ship 6' — 8' lengths to fill this order.

Return Policy
- Our terms of sale are F.O.B. our factory. The responsibility for damage in transit is the carrier's, whether it is visible or concealed damage.
- Inspect your shipment immediately. Insist that visible damages be indicated on your copy of the freight bill.
- Open boxes within 15 days of delivery, inspect for concealed damages and report any discrepancies. No adjustments will be made for discrepancies not reported within 15 days of receipt.
- In case of damage, notify the delivering carrier immediately, requesting that inspection be made. Place a phone call to the delivery carrier and confirm with a written report, holding a copy of the request for claim purposes.
- We take every precaution to ensure safe arrival, but our responsibility ceases when the shipment is turned over to the carrier.
- Claims of damages must be made by you to the carrier within 15 days of receipt of delivery.
Return Goods
- Do not return any product without our authorization.
- Call Customer Service and obtain a Return Goods Authorization (RGA#). We will fax you a shipping label that MUST be used.
- Returned products must have packaging equal to original factory packaging (with adequate protective padding material and cardboard securely fastened.) White River™ WILL NOT be responsible for damage incurred because of insufficient packaging.
- Special and custom-manufactured items cannot be returned.
- Return merchandise will not be accepted by us from the carrier unless it is returned freight prepaid within 15 days of the return authorization date. Packages must be clearly marked with the RGA number.
